The Purpose of an Education is to help a child become an independent adult.
 

 
 
 

"The purpose of an education is to teach a student how to live his life—by developing his mind and equipping him to deal with reality. The training he needs is theoretical, i.e., conceptual. He has to be taught to think, to understand, to integrate, to prove. He has to be taught the essentials of the knowledge discovered in the past—and he has to be equipped to acquire further knowledge by his own effort."

AYN RAND

 


 


The purpose of this site is to provide resources on providing your child with an objective education. Such an education focuses on developing a child's conceptual faculty, so that by the time the child grows up to become an adult, it will have the means to think and act independently.
